About Henderson, Kentucky

Henderson is a thriving urban community located in Henderson County, Kentucky, approximately 115 miles from Fort Knox military installation. With a population of 28,469 residents, Henderson offers urban conveniences and cultural amenities.

Employment and Economy

Henderson's economy is anchored by major employers including Tyson Foods, Methodist Hospital, Gibbs Die Casting, providing diverse employment opportunities across multiple sectors. Education and Schools

Education is a priority in Henderson, with schools earning an average rating of 6.5 out of 10. The area is served by Henderson County Schools, which has earned a "Proficient" rating. The district serves 7,800 students across 11 schools.
